Web10 de jan. de 2024 · Add contents from your drained can of pinto beans into your microwave-safe bowl, add in half a cup of water, and mix. Cover and cook for about 2 minutes. Uncover, add in your desired seasonings, mix again, cover again and cook for another 2-3 minutes until beans are warmed through. Cook In A Slow Cooker. Web1 de fev. de 2024 · Canned beans are ready to be consumed, while dried beans need a little TLC before they can be eaten. First, they need to be soaked overnight in water to start softening (though if you’re pressed for time, bringing them to a boil and letting them soak for an hour will do the trick). WebHow to prepare cannellini beans. Canned beans just need to be drained and rinsed, then they're ready to use. For dried beans, soak them in lots of cold water for a minimum of 5 hours (they'll expand, so make sure your bowl is big). Drain and rinse, then put them in a large pan, cover with 5cm of cold water, bring to the boil, scoop off any foam ...

Next, the cans are sealed and placed in a canning … synthesis of benzilic acid from benzoinWeb26 de abr. de 2024 · Dried beans are cheaper than canned beans. According to The Bean Institute, “a one pound bag of dry pinto beans costs, on average, $1.79 and will make 12 half-cup servings of cooked beans whereas a 15-ounce can of national brand pinto beans costs $1.69.
